About Campanar

Campanar is a charming neighborhood located just northwest of Valencia's city center, making it an ideal choice for international students seeking a homestay. The area boasts excellent transport links, including the Valencia Metro, which connects you to the city center in approximately 15 minutes. Bus services also run frequently, providing easy access to various parts of the city. For those studying at nearby institutions, such as the University of Valencia and the Polytechnic University of Valencia, commuting is both convenient and quick, allowing you to focus on your studies and enjoy your experience in this vibrant city.

In addition to its practical transport options, Campanar offers a rich local culture and several points of interest. The beautiful Turia Gardens, a former riverbed turned into a lush park, is perfect for leisurely strolls or picnics with friends. The nearby Mercado de Campanar is a bustling market where you can sample local delicacies and immerse yourself in Spanish cuisine. Additionally, the charming architecture of the area, including the historic Church of Campanar, adds to the neighborhood's appeal.
